Government enforces new regulation requiring price transparency in both brick-and-mortar stores and online platforms

If you’re tired of hidden prices and awkward cashier moments while shopping, you’ll be pleased to hear that the Ministry of Industry and Commerce in Bahrain has taken a stand to protect consumers. In response to widespread complaints about unclear pricing and uncomfortable checkout situations, the Ministry has mandated that all prices must be clearly displayed not only in physical stores but also on social media pages and websites. This new rule aims to eliminate hidden fees and prevent any surprises at checkout, ensuring transparency for shoppers.

Under the new regulations, signs stating “no returns or exchanges” are strictly prohibited. Additionally, when goods are showcased online, customers have a legal period of 15 days from the date of receipt to inspect the product, as stipulated by Law No. 35 of 2012 regarding consumer protection. It is also forbidden to display phrases like “sold goods are not returnable or exchangeable” on sales pages, ensuring that consumers have the right to return or exchange items if necessary.

The Ministry of Industry and Commerce has emphasized that price advertising requirements extend beyond physical stores to include social media pages and online store websites. This means that all prices must be clearly displayed across all platforms where goods are being sold, providing consumers with the information they need to make informed purchasing decisions. By enforcing these regulations, the Ministry is standing up for consumers and working to ensure fair and transparent shopping experiences for all.
